Symptoms

ADHD can be the reason behind your frequent key loss and inability to finish tasks at work, or getting interrupted by family or friends. This condition can affect up to 8.4% children and 2.5 percentage of adults. It can have a profound impact on both personal and professional lives. Many people don't know the cause of their symptoms is ADHD and do not seek help because they don't know what to do. They may attempt to manage themselves but this can be a challenge.

There isn't a physical or medical test for ADHD but a trained mental health specialist will draw information from a variety of sources to determine an assessment, which may include the symptom checklists and the standardized behaviour rating scales, aswell an extensive review of the person's history and present functioning, as well as information from those who are familiar with their condition. Based on the nature of the individual's issues, additional psychological, neuropsychological or testing for learning disabilities could be conducted.

Certain people with ADHD may also suffer from co-occurring illnesses, like depression and anxiety and depression, so it's crucial for a doctor to rule these out. A healthcare professional will typically look for other medical disorders that can lead to similar symptoms, for example, the thyroid disorder or obesity.

Diagnosis

If you believe that you or someone you know suffers from ADHD, the first step is to consult your GP. They might be able refer you to a private specialist like psychologist or psychiatrist who is skilled in diagnosing adults suffering from ADHD. You can also contact the specialists directly to schedule an assessment. Before you can make an appointment with the doctor you'll need to complete an assessment form regarding the symptoms you've been experiencing. You will also be asked to supply information about your mental health background, including any previous psychiatric treatments you may have received.

It is essential to be open about your symptoms with the physician, as you will need to provide complete medical history to ensure an accurate diagnosis. The doctor will examine your family, personal medical history, and psychiatric history along with your current symptoms and concerns. They will then utilize this information to determine whether you suffer from ADHD and the severity of your symptoms. They will also determine if other mental health issues, such as anxiety or depression, could be causing your symptoms.

Depending on the situation, you may require additional psycho-educational, learning disabilities, or neuropsychological testing. This can help rule out other conditions that could cause ADHD symptoms. Some people who suffer from ADHD may also have autism or other learning disabilities, which could cause similar symptoms. It is important to discuss treatment options with your doctor after you've been diagnosed. They can suggest therapy and medication that can assist you in managing your symptoms. There are a variety of therapies designed specifically for adults with ADHD, including c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) as well as mindfulness and acceptance commitment therapy.

A diagnosis of ADHD can be a great relief, particularly for adults. It could be that it clarifies a lot about the reasons you've been struggling in the past and that can be empowering and freeing. It's also important to be aware that many adults struggle with self-esteem issues when they are diagnosed. Therapy, specifically narrative therapy, can be helpful for these individuals to learn to tell their own stories differently and alter the way they perceive themselves.

The field of psychiatry is a complicated field and it is not uncommon for people with ADHD to experience symptoms that aren't ADHD. It's crucial to find a psychiatrist with an understanding of the uk adult adhd diagnosis ADHD and who is an expert in the diagnosis. A thorough assessment will require collecting information from you as well as your family and friends as well as school reports and an assessment questionnaire. Your clinician will analyze these findings to determine whether you suffer from ADHD and then develop an overall treatment plan that may include therapy or medication.

It is also advisable to check with your GP to determine whether they're willing sign a shared care agreement with you and with your psychologist prior to seeking the private ADHD diagnosis. You'll only have to pay the NHS prescription fee for your medication. Some doctors will not do this, so it's best to confirm this before paying for an assessment.
